LICENSE OPTIONS FOR THE FOLLOWING SOFTWARE PRODUCTS. OnWebTM, RUMBATM, ViewNowTM, Modernization WorkbenchTM, Analyzer ExpressTM, Analyzer Architect TM, Business Rule Manager TM, Enterprise View Express TM, Data ExpressTM, Mainframe Express Enterprise Edition Data ExpressTM, Modernisation Workbench Data Express®, OPTIMAL TRACE®, QACENTER®, QADIRECTOR®, QALOAD®, QARUN®, RECONCILE®, TESTPARTNER®, TRACKRECORD®, CARS®, TEST FACTORYTM, DEVPARTNER® including portions thereof, other products within the same product families and other Software Products where indicated by Licensor. 1. Workstation License Licensed Software provided under this License Option gives Licensee the right to install and use one copy of the Licensed Software on one stand-alone workstation. Licensee may not (i) install the Licensed Software on any networked workstation (e.g., a server) that allows more than one user to use a copy of the Licensed Software, or (ii) use the Licensed Software other than on one stand-alone workstation at a time. Licensee may transfer the Licensed Software to another stand -alone workstation and reactivate it for use on such other stand-alone workstation provided that the Licensed Software is removed and all copies of it are deleted from the stand -alone workstation from which it is transferred. Such transfers may not be undertaken more often than once every 30 days. 2. Named User License Licensed Software provided under this License Option gives Licensee the right to install the Licensed Software on either (i) a single machine which may be accessed by the named end users for those licenses or (ii) on one or more host machines or servers which may be accessed by any of the named end users licensed. A Named User License means that only one named person can use each license and that named person has the right to unlimited access to the Licensed Software. A Named User License is not based on concurrent use rs, but instead on an actual named user basis. Licensor reserves the right at any time to require Licensee to provide a list of the named end users. Licensee may change a named end user provided that the change is made either permanently away from the named end user or temporarily to accommodate the use of the Licensed Software by a temporary worker while the named end user is absent, but in no event more than once eve ry 30 days. 3. Volume of Data Licensed Software provided under this option gives Licensee the right to utilize the Licensed Software with the volume of data (the number of terabytes) identified in the Product Order for each of the applicable modules or extensions licensed with the Licensed Software. Volume of data is measured as the original volume of Licensee‟ production data to be processed utilizing the Licensed Software before any data reduction process by the Licensed Software or otherwise has been applied. The same data source (defined as a database table or a file) and data may be processed multiple times without counting it more than once towards the total volume of data processed by the Licensed Software, however any additional data and/or data sources (that is, new or increased amounts to the original data source) are counted c umulatively towards such total volume of data number. 4. Concurrent User License Licensed Software provided under this License Option gives Licensee the right to install and use one copy of the Licensed Software on the designated Host Server (as defined above) specified in the Product Order for use by the maximum number of Concurrent Users (defined above) for whom Licensee has paid the applicable license fee. Licensee may connect any number of workstations to the Host Server; however, the total number of users who may access and use the Licensed Software at any given time is limited by the number of Concurrent Users expressly authorized by Licensor in the Product Order. The total number of Concurrent Users is one (1), unless Licensor expressly authorized Licensee to connect more than one Concurrent User.
